We travel to Branson several times a year and like to try out a lot of the newer places each time we go. I've passed by a few times and my wife and I decided to give it a go this past week as we had never previously been there. Start to finish, it was not a good experience.The entry is on the side of the building, not the front. I think this was previously a different business/restaurant, possibly affiliated with the hotel. But I would have thought some renovations would have made sense since then. Almost the entire interior is shades of grey with no character at all. It felt more like we were walking into a church basement for a potluck than into a restaurant. There are pictures on the walls that are supposed to be honoring heroes but otherwise it's drab and ugly.The restaurant wasn't busy at all. We observed at least 4 servers working. I don't time things exactly, but the server took a bit long just to stop quickly at the table to tell us she'd be right with us. It was close to another 10 minutes before she returned. It's hard to say what exactly she was doing as it appeared she only had 2 other tables besides ours and disappeared into the back for a long time and came out empty handed.We ordered everything at once (water, drinks from the bar and food) for fear it would be too long again before her return. She brought the water pretty much right away. The bar drinks took a very long time. They weren't delivered by the server, but by someone else who I'm assuming got tired of them not being picked up. Our entrees arrived less than 1 minute after we had finally received our drinks (also not delivered by the server)As a general rule, I expect food from a restaurant to be better than something I can make at home. It failed on all counts. The pork chop was seasoned well, but was chewy (which we related to the server who reacted with "oh" and walked away). The meatloaf was very plain. The mashed potatoes tasted like they were made from boxed potatoes with a beef gravy like they were from a TV dinner. The brussel sprouts were plain. The carrots were about the only redeeming item as they were actually cooked thru and somewhat soft.Start to finish, the only stops the server made at the table were those noted above and then to drop the check. The ticket was about $70 which was so discouraging to have to pay that much for the experience.It was very disappointing start to finish and with numerous dining options in town, we won't be returning.
